Transaction 32ff1854ebf11057f65e71d69107fdf42078bddfc3f735bba89cf764088cd8f1
1 Input
2 Outputs
- 32ff1854ebf11057f65e71d69107fdf42078bddfc3f735bba89cf764088cd8f1:0
- 32ff1854ebf11057f65e71d69107fdf42078bddfc3f735bba89cf764088cd8f1:1
value 4629705
address 1LzuzK6Ef84Mtr5AZjukLy3ycBsU1fmXTz
value 17496101
address 3P8fEDwtWcEPcBYe61kZWvZcezqf39gKXY